Output 17bcdb624ab6d590d723e609fd63cfe4adb38a0ccde9db67af30155ff2060f4b:1

value
10895784
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4df10ef6f2661bdde58b841a51f22073b300b81f OP_EQUALVERIFY OP_CHECKSIG
address
1877ookcd3R78G5aRhEYWkspMrpQ95Sk2M
transaction
17bcdb624ab6d590d723e609fd63cfe4adb38a0ccde9db67af30155ff2060f4b
spent
true